Ajax expects Manchester United to make a second approach for Antony and is preparing for his future exit by seeking former playmaker Hakim Ziyech, according to 90min.
Since Erik ten Hag came over at Old Trafford, Antony has been Erik ten Hag’s first choice offensive target, but Ajax’s demand for a club-record cost of £78 million has put United on hold. The Red Devils’ sluggish start to the season, though, has forced them to reconsider their transfer strategy, and Antony remains the man they are anxious to sign up front.
United’s latest offer for Anthony is £10m below the asking price from Ajax, but sources confirmed at 90 minutes that the Eredivisie giants are hoping for an improved offer. Ajax are making plans to replace Antony as his exit seems more imminent, and insiders have revealed to 90min that out-of-favour Chelsea playmaker Hakim Ziyech is being lined up for a return to Amsterdam. Thomas Tuchel has told the 29-year-old, nicknamed as ‘The Wizard’ during his four-year time at Ajax between 2016 and 2020, that he may leave Stamford Bridge. He was previously linked with AC Milan.
However, Ajax are now attempting to launch a loan deal for Ziyech, which might pave the way for Antony to eventually join United. Even if Antony does sign, 90min believes that United do not aim to bring in just one attacker, implying that PSV Eindhoven’s Cody Gakpo and Chelsea’s Christian Pulisic would not be overlooked.
